法兰克数控系统程序要点 基本格式与核心要素解析
2024-12-17
来源:
FC法律
法兰克数控系统程序要点及核心要素解析
一、引言
法兰克(FANUC)数控系统是工业自动化领域的重要一环,广泛应用于机械制造行业。作为一款先进的数控系统,其程序设计必须遵循特定的规则和标准,以确保系统的稳定性和操作的安全性。本文将围绕法兰克数控系统的程序要点进行详细分析,并探讨其核心要素的含义及其在实践中的应用。
二、程序设计的基本原则
- 安全性:这是所有数控系统编程的首要考虑因素。法兰克的程序设计应确保设备在运行过程中不会对人员或环境造成任何伤害。例如,紧急停止按钮的设计应该易于访问,并且在发生危险情况时立即有效。
- 精确性:数控机床要求加工精度高,因此程序设计的每个环节都必须考虑到这一点。从刀具的选择到切削参数的设定,都需要经过精密计算。
- 可维护性:程序设计应具备良好的可读性和可理解性,以便于维护和故障排除。清晰明了的注释和逻辑结构有助于技术人员快速定位和解决问题。
- 适应性:程序设计应具有一定的灵活性,以应对不同的工作环境和生产需求。这通常涉及到对程序模块的重组和调整。
- 效率:高效的程序设计可以减少加工时间,提高生产力。通过优化路径规划、选择合适的进给速度等手段,可以达到这一目标。
三、核心要素解析
- G代码:G代码是数控机床指令的核心部分,它控制着机床的运动、刀具的操作以及辅助功能。法兰克的G代码种类繁多,每一种都有特定的用途。例如,G01表示线性插补运动,而G02则用于顺时针圆弧插补。
- M代码:M代码主要用于控制机床的非加工动作,如主轴启停、冷却液开关等。例如,M06用于换刀指令,而M08则是开冷却液的动作。
- S代码:S代码用来设置主轴的速度,单位为转速(RPM)。例如,S1000表示主轴将以1000转/分钟的速度旋转。
- T代码:T代码用于选刀指令,例如T01代表选择第一号刀具。
- L代码:L代码常用于指定刀具的长度补偿值,例如L100表示刀具长度补偿值为+100毫米。
四、案例分析
在实际的生产环境中,法兰克数控系统的程序设计和执行可能会遇到各种各样的问题。以下是一个典型的案例分析:
某汽车零件制造商在使用法兰克数控机床加工铝合金零部件的过程中,发现某些零件的表面出现了微小的划痕。经调查发现,这些划痕是由于程序中刀具轨迹的加减速变化过于剧烈所导致的。解决方案是通过修改程序,采用更加平滑的加减速曲线,从而减少了刀具的震动和不必要的摩擦。这个例子说明了程序设计对于产品质量的重要性。
五、结论
法兰克数控系统的程序设计是一门综合性的技术学科,涉及了安全、精度和效率等多个方面。只有充分理解和掌握了程序设计的各个要点和核心要素,才能编写出高质量的数控程序,从而实现高效稳定的生产过程。随着技术的不断进步,程序员也需要不断地更新自己的知识和技能,以适应新的挑战和要求。
相关推荐
热门资讯
友情链接: